Crystal structure of {[Nb(η-5-C5H4SiMe3)Cl]2(μ-O)(μ-OOC6H4)2} %D 1987 %@ 0022-328X %U http://hdl.handle.net/10017/4935 %X Alcoholysis with catechol or substitution reactions with NaOPh on Nb(¿5-C5H4R)Cl4 (R = H, SiMe3) have given new alkoxoniobium(V) derivatives of the type Nb(η5-C5H4R)Cl3(OPh) (R = H, SiMe3) Nb(η5-C6H5)Cl2(O2C6H4) and {[Nb(η5-C5H4SiMe3)Cl]2(μ-O)(μ-O2C6H4)2}. The crystal structure of the last species has been studied. The two metal atoms, 3.079(1) Å apart, are symmetrically bridged by the oxo and the two catechol ligands. The two oxygen atoms of each catecholate group are coordinated to the metal atoms, one of them to one Nb atom and the other bridging the two Nb atoms. Chloride and CpSiMe3 ligands complete the coordination sphere of both metal atoms. %K Alcoholysis %K Crystal structure %K Niobium %K Ciencia %K Química inorgánica %K Science %K Chemistry, inorganic %~ Biblioteca Universidad de Alcala
